A Predictive Model for Farmland Purchase/Rent Using Random Forests
정호연,김영준,임소영 한국농업경제학회 2022 農業經濟硏究 Vol.63 No.3
This study contributes to guidance for understanding farmland purchase and rent decisions in Korea via an analysis using a machine learning tool, Random Forests: A Supervised Machine Learning Algorithm. Farm Household Economy Survey is employed to predict the relationship between farmland acquisition and farm household economic characteristics. Our main findings are two folds. First, a farmland purchase decision is positively related to transfer incomes, the value of inventory & fixed assets, and the value of farmland that farmers owned. Second, a farmland rent decision is also positively associated with a rent paid in a prior year, revenue from field crops, inventory and agricultural assets, and transfer incomes.
USCG 형식승인을 위한 선박용 고정식 CO2 소화설비의 진동 특성 연구
정호연,조재상,구희모,배진욱,조종래 한국소음진동공학회 2022 한국소음진동공학회 논문집 Vol.32 No.5
In accordance with the USCG type approval procedure, a fixed CO2 fire-extinguishing system is mounted on a ship after obtaining type approval. For it to pass the vibration test for type approval, an appropriate vibration resistance design is required. In this study, we analyzed the severity of the vibration test standard UL2127 and developed a modularized test method for USCG type approval. Based on the proposed test method, the vibration response characteristics of each module were evaluated with three-axis vibration test machines. In the case of the cylinder module, damage was caused by excessive vibrations due to resonance, which can be mitigated by changing the rigidity of the boundary structure and shifting the natural frequency out of the frequency range of interest.

대학생의 성장기 부모화 경험과 우울증상의 관계에서 정서표현 양가성의 매개효과
정호연 한국청소년학회 2018 청소년학연구 Vol.25 No.5
The purpose of this study was to examine the mediating effects of ambivalence over emotional expressiveness between childhood parentification and depressive symptoms. The subjects of this study were 411 university students located in Seoul and Gyeonggi Province. The measurement scales used were Filial Responsibility Scale-Adult (FRS-A), the Center for Epidemiologic Studies for depression scale (CES-D), Ambivalence over Emotional Expressiveness Questionnaire (AEQ-K). The results are as follows:There were significant positive correlations among childhood parentification, ambivalence over emotional expressiveness and depressive symptoms. Furthermore, In the verification of the mediating effects, they turned out the ambivalence over emotional expressiveness had partial mediating effects between childhood parentification and depressive symptoms. This study confirmed the childhood parentification and ambivalence over emotional expressiveness to explain depressive symptoms. 본 연구는 대학생의 성장기 부모화 경험의 각 하위요인이 우울증상에 미치는 영향에서 정서표현 양가성의 매개효과를 검증하고자 하였다. 이를 위해 서울 및 경기 소재 대학교에 재학 중인 대학생 450명을 대상으로 2017년 6월부터 9월까지 약 3달간에 걸쳐 설문지를 배부하였으며, 회수된 설문지 가운데 무응답 및 자료로 이용하기에 부적절한 질문지를 제외한 총 411부를 분석 자료로 활용하였다. 연구 결과를 살펴봤을 때, 정서적 부모화, 물리적 부모화, 불공평은 각각 정서표현양가성과 우울 증상에 정적 상관을 보였고, 정서표현 양가성과 우울증상 또한 정적상관을 보였다. 매개효과를 검증한 결과, 대학생의 성장기 부모화 경험의 하위요인인 정서적 부모화, 물리적 부모화, 불공평은 모두 정서표현 양가성을 부분 매개로 하여 우울증상을 유의하게 설명하는 것으로 나타났다. 이러한 결과는 대학생의 성장기 부모화 경험과 우울 증상의 관계에서 정서표현 양가성이 중요한 역할을 함을 시사한다. 이와 같은 결과를 바탕으로 본연구의 의의와 제한점에 대하여 논의하였다.
수정 유전알고리듬을 사용한 최대유통문제의 치명호 결정방법
정호연,김은영 전주대학교 공학기술종합연구소 1998 전주대학교 공학기술종합연구소 학술논문집 Vol.4 No.2
The purpose of this study is to present a method for determining the k most vital arcs in the maximum flow problem using genetic algorithms. Generally, the problem which determine the k most vital arcs in maximum flow problem has known as NP-hard. Therefore, in this study we propose a method for determining all the k most vital arcs in maximum flow problem using a genetic algorithm and a revised genetic algorithm. First, we propose genetic algorithm to find the k most vital arcs removed at the same time then present the expression and determination method of individuals compatible with the characteristics of the problem, and specify the genetic parameter values of constitution, population size, crossover rate, mutation rate and etc. of the initial population which makes detecting efficiency better. Finally, using the proposed algorithm, we analyzed the performance of searching optimal solution through computer experiment. The proposed algorithms found all alternatives within shorter time than other heuristic methods. The method presented in this study can determine all the alternatives when there exists other alternative solutions.
